RESUME 445 Lázár introduces his career in a comprehensive article illustrated with reproductions in Művészet. The winter exhibition of the Art Gallery introduces Chest with Tulips, (cat. 48) > Woman in Interior in front of a Yellow Curtain (cat. 32); Lying Model (cat. 34); Peasant Girl (cat. 52); Resting Socac (cat. 53); Züzü in the Stroller (Züzü in the Cradle, Züzü in the Little Stroller, cat. 68); Bathing Women (cat. 121) 1911 He participates in an international exhibition in Rome with a more extensive collection, where Thamar (VI 1.9) is purchased by the Italian State for the Galleria Moderna in Rome. The Italian Minister of Edu­cation invites Csók to paint something for the self-portrait collection in the Uffizzi Gallery. He works on landscapes and beach scenes in Balatonaliga and in Lido, Venice.The portrait of Tibor Wlassics (1.25), which is introduced at the jubilee exhibition of the Society of Fine Arts, receives the grand state gold medal. He and his family relocate to a flat at 52 Damjanich Street, in the 7th district, close to the City Park. The Modern Magyar Képtár, edited by Miklós Rózsa, brings out the lino-cut adaption of Socac Funeral. (XV.22) He creates a large ar­caded panno in Miksa Schiffer's villa in Budapest. > Apple Tree Blossom (cat. 89); Schiffer-Villa Panno, draft (cat. 92); The Panno of the Schiffer-Villa (cat. 93); Landscape ofAliga (cat. 112) 1912 In the summer he represents himself with several pictures in a ju­bilee exhibition of the "Nagybánya" artists. His wife and daughter spend a month at the grandparents'in Római Fürdő. He displays his self-portrait, painted for the Uffizi Gallery in Florence, in the Ernst Museum in the autumn. (IV.58) He participates in the Autumn Salon in Paris. He continues the Lidó and Züzü-period. His Corner of the Atelier wins the grand gold medal at the international exhi­bition in Amsterdam. > Self-portrait, draft (cat. 1 ); Still-life with a Chinese Sculpture (cat. 42); Züzü with the Rooster (Züzü and Koko, Züzü and Coco, cat. 71 ); Sea Beach (cat. 124) 1913 He is present at the dedication of the Art House Palace. Corner of theAtelieris displayed in the international exhibition of Glaspalastt in Munich after Paris and Amsterdam. He spends the summer in Balatonaliga with his family; later, he follows his wife and daughter to Római Fürdő where he stays for a few weeks. > Breakfast Table (Flower and Fruit, cat. 97); Winter in Spring (cat. 101); Gellért ff ilI in Winter (cat. 102) 1914 His retrospective exhibition, celebrating his 25-year-long career, opens on February 18th in the Art Gallery, where 142 works are dis­played in 8 rooms. Arsène Alexandre, arts writer and critic for the renowned L'Événement and the Le Figaro, writes the introduction to the richly illustrated catalogue. His painting is analyzed and praised at great length by all significant papers. Two Idols (IV.59) appears at the exhibition of the Art House in Vienna and other works are displayed in the 11th Venice Biennale. > Thamar (cat. 21 ); Little Buddha Statuette (Chinese Doll, cat. 40); Züzü under the Christmas Tree (cat. 73); Resting Züzü (cat. 75) 1915 He shows the first series of the Lake Balaton pictures at the group exhibition of Ernst Museum. He spends the summer with his family in Balatonaliga. He wins a gold medal at the World Expo in San Francisco. > Züzü is dancing (cat. 77) 1916 He has an exhibition together with József Rippl-Rónai and Gyula Kosztolányi-Kann in Nagyvárad. > Merry-making Company with a Peacock (cat. 94); Bathing Woman (cat. 114) 1917 He lives in the Hunfalvy House, located on the hillside of the castle close to his secondary school, from August until 1921 .The flat's rose garden and its view of the Danube inspire numerous pictures. Heap­­pears with a larger collection of his new works in the Ernst Museum. In addition to his Balaton pictures, he begins varying his themes. > Erzsébet Báthory, draft (cat. 15); Züzü in the Bower (Züzü on the Island, cat. 78); Woman in Yellow Gown (cat. 99) 1918 He displays a dozen pictures, including landscapes, Thamar and Susanna variations, in the Ernst Museum. The first version of his memorials appears in ffungarians. > Thamar (cat. 20); Züzü at the Window (Züzü is learning, Spring in Winter, cat. 82); Outlook out of the Roses (cat. 96) 1919 He is appointed to a professorship of figure drawing alongside Mi­hály Bíró and Bertalan Pór by the Art Directorate of the Hungarian Soviet Republic. When Gyula Peidl’s government comes to power he resigns and returns his salary. 1920 Károly Lyka invites him to become a professor of figure drawing and painting in the College of Fine Arts. He is elected president of the Szinyei Merse Society. > Thamar (cat. 19); Socac Girls on the Shore (cat. 50); Sewing Socac Girl (cat. 51); Resting Socac (cat. 54); Dolce far niente (cat. 65); Bathing Women (cat. 120)
